Supported element types for FEM acoustic analysis

The available element types depend on whether you are running an acoustic or vibro-acoustic analysis.

Supported element types for acoustic analyses

Element family Element type Nastran bulk data entry
3D Hexahedral (linear and parabolic) CHEXA
Tetrahedral (linear and parabolic) CTETRA
Wedge (linear and parabolic) CPENTA
Pyramid (linear and parabolic) CPYRAM
2D Plane Strain Triangle (linear and parabolic) CPLSTN3, CPLSTN6
Plane Strain Quadrilateral (linear and parabolic) CPLSTN4, CPLSTN8
Plane Stress Triangle (linear and parabolic) CPLSTS3, CPLSTS6
Plane Stress Quadrilateral (linear and parabolic) CPLSTS4, CPLSTS8
Axisymmetric Triangle (linear and parabolic) CTRAX3, CTRAX6
Axisymmetric Quadrilateral (linear and parabolic) CQUADX4, CQUADX8
1D Rigid Bar RBAR
Rigid Link RBE2
0D Concentrated Mass CONM1, CONM2
